State of Louisiana Selects 麻豆原创 Software to Transform HR

WALLDORF听鈥 (NYSE: 麻豆原创) today announced that the state of Louisiana has selected 麻豆原创 software to move its human resources (HR) technology to the cloud and build a foundation to transform its people strategy.

鈥淐OVID-19 has permanently shifted the way we all conduct business due to the necessity of teleworking,鈥 said Louisiana Chief Information Officer Richard 鈥淒ickie鈥 Howze. 鈥淐loud computing allows the Office of Technology Services to meet the rapidly evolving needs of the state agencies we serve. It鈥檚 not a luxury anymore; it鈥檚 a necessity.鈥

These 麻豆原创 SuccessFactors solutions will help the state of Louisiana, an existing 麻豆原创 customer, modernize and incorporate data-driven decision-making into its talent processes.

鈥淭here鈥檚 an unspoken urgency to bridge the technological gap many government agencies face, not only to meet citizen expectations and deliver on critical missions but also to recruit young talent,鈥 said Brian Roach, 麻豆原创 North America senior vice president and managing director of Regulated Industries. 鈥淭he state of Louisiana is taking that challenge head on in the fastest, most flexible way to transform with cloud-based solutions.鈥

鈥淲ith 麻豆原创 SuccessFactors solutions for talent management, the state of Louisiana can transform how it attracts, retains and supports top talent,鈥 said Maryann Abbajay, 麻豆原创 SuccessFactors chief revenue officer. 鈥淚n today鈥檚 competitive talent market, organizations need to deliver engaging experiences that start with recruitment and continue as a person grows and develops their career.鈥

The state of Louisiana joins a growing list of local, state and federal government entities collaborating with 麻豆原创 to power cloud-enabled processes that help fulfill the needs of citizens, employees and other government stakeholders. In May, 麻豆原创 announced that Arapahoe County, part of the Denver metropolitan area, had completed its migration to 麻豆原创 S/4HANA, cementing it as a technology leader in the public sector.
